Fig. 3. ppn-1 expression in the DTC and regulation by hlh-2. Eggs from ppn-1::GFP nematodes were hatched and grown on bacteria carrying an RNAi construct for hlh-2 or on bacteria with a control plasmid. After 48 hours, Nomarski and fluorescence images were captured using identical exposure settings (A). DTC locations are indicated with arrowheads. DTC paths are diagrammed at the left. (B) Equal-sized ovals were centered around the DTCs on the Nomarski images and fluorescence intensities within the ovals were measured for ten animals from each condition using IPLab software. The average fluorescence ± s.d. for control and hlh-2 RNAi experiments are shown. (C) An embryo expressing ppn-1::GFP shows expression in the DTC precursor cells Z1 and Z4 indicated by arrowheads in the fluorescence image. The gonad primordium is outlined in the Nomarski image.
